Part Time Virtual Medical Scribe information

What are some common challenges faced by part time virtual medical scribes and how can they be managed?

Part-time virtual medical scribes often face challenges such as adapting to different providers’ documentation styles, managing fluctuating patient loads, and maintaining focus during long periods of remote work. To manage these challenges, it’s helpful to develop strong communication skills to clarify provider preferences, stay organized with digital note-taking tools, and establish a distraction-free workspace. Regular feedback from supervising physicians and participation in training sessions can also support continuous improvement and job satisfaction.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time virtual medical scribe?

To thrive as a Part Time Virtual Medical Scribe, you need a solid understanding of medical terminology, strong typing skills, and attention to detail, often supported by a relevant certification or experience in healthcare documentation. Familiarity with electronic health records (EHR) systems and secure communication platforms is typically required. Excellent listening, time management, and written communication skills help ensure accurate and timely documentation. These competencies are crucial for maintaining efficient, compliant, and high-quality medical records that support clinical workflows.

What is a part time virtual medical scribe?

A Part Time Virtual Medical Scribe is a professional who remotely assists healthcare providers with documentation during patient visits. Working part-time, they listen to or view patient encounters in real-time and accurately enter information into electronic health records (EHRs). This role helps doctors focus more on patient care by reducing their administrative workload. Virtual scribes typically work from home, and their schedules often vary based on the needs of the healthcare practice.

What is the difference between Part Time Virtual Medical Scribe vs Part Time Medical Assistant?

AspectPart Time Virtual Medical ScribePart Time Medical Assistant
CredentialsNone required, but medical terminology knowledge helpfulCertified or trained in medical assisting programs
Work EnvironmentRemote, working with physicians' electronic health recordsClinical setting, assisting with patient care and procedures
Employer & IndustryHospitals, clinics, healthcare providersHospitals, outpatient clinics, medical offices
Primary TasksTranscribing medical notes, documenting patient encountersPatient intake, vital signs, basic clinical tasks

While both roles support healthcare operations, a Part Time Virtual Medical Scribe focuses on documenting patient visits remotely, whereas a Part Time Medical Assistant performs clinical tasks in person. The choice depends on your skills and preferred work environment.
